一种通话质量测试系统及方法

文档序号:9276923阅读:3996来源:国知局
一种通话质量测试系统及方法
【技术领域】
[0001]本发明涉及移动通信技术领域,尤其涉及一种通话质量测试系统及方法。
【背景技术】
[0002]众所周知,对于一款手机,其最主要也是最基本的功能就是通话,如何有效的测试手机通话质量一直是一个难题。2G网络是一个以语音通话为主的承载业务的网络,语音质量与掉话率,接通率是并行的语音通话三大网络指标之一,但一直以来没有准确的指标来衡量,不得以借用BER(Bit Error Rate,误码率),FER(Frame Error Rate,误帧率)等参数表征。
[0003]现代通信网络无法通过信噪比来完全确切来评估通信质量,目前手机通话质量评估方面一般利用网络中的一些客观参数来反映语音质量,如信噪比,误码率等。但是客观参数不能准确的反应人们的主观感受,因此听觉域的评估方法更受关注。
[0004]在主观手机通话质量测试方法,目前往往是单个测试人员测试,但无法客观的体现语音通话质量,另外在测试场景方面也比较单一,无法覆盖到各种网络环境,在测试结果的可靠性方面受到各方质疑。

【发明内容】

[0005]本发明的目的是提供一种通话质量测试系统及方法,结合用户的主观感受和不同网络环境实现通话质量的有效测试。
[0006]本发明提供的技术方案如下:
[0007]一种通话质量测试系统,包括测试装置和服务器端;
[0008]所述测试装置包括依序相连的:
[0009]检测模块,用于检测所述终端在语音通话时是否满足测试条件;以及,当所述终端满足测试条件时发送启动通话质量测试命令;
[0010]数据采集模块,用于当接收到启动通话质量测试命令时采集所述终端的测试数据并发送至测试信息生成模块;
[0011]所述测试信息生成模块,用于根据所述测试数据生成测试信息,并发送至第一通信模块;
[0012]所述第一通信模块,用于发送所述测试信息至服务器端;
[0013]所述服务器端包括依序相连的:
[0014]第二通信模块,用于接收所述第一通信模块发送的所述测试信息并转发至处理模块;
[0015]所述处理模块,用于接收并解析所述测试信息得到所述测试数据;以及,统计所述测试数据得到通话质量测试结果。
[0016]本发明主要通话批量采集测试数据(测试数据包含了各种人群,各种网络环境,各个不同基站,及其个人对于语音质量的感受的差异性)汇总到服务器,再进行算法过滤来得出相对客观的通话质量测试结果,达到测试结果的客观性。
[0017]进一步优选的,所述测试数据包括语音质量信息和语音参数信息。
[0018]进一步优选的,还包括网络检测单元,用于检测所述终端当前网络是否满足语音通话条件,以及,当满足语音通话条件时发送判断结果为是至控制单元;
[0019]发送次数判断单元,用于判断所述控制单元发送所述启动通话质量测试命令的发送次数是否低于第一预设阈值;以及,当所述发送次数低于所述第一预设阈值时,发送第一判断结果为是至所述控制单元;
[0020]通话时长判断单元,用于在所述终端一次语音通话结束时,统计并判断通话时长是否达到第二预设阈值;以及,当所述通话时长达到第二预设阈值时发送第二判断结果为是至控制单元;
[0021]所述控制单元,用于当接收到所述网络检测单元发送的判断结果、所述第一判断结果为以及所述第二判断结果同时为是时,发送启动通话质量测试命令;
[0022]发送次数累加单元,用于当所述控制单元发送一次启动通话质量测试命令时,累加一次所述发送次数。
[0023]进一步优选的,所述数据采集模块包括语音质量采集单元,用于采集用户输入的语音质量信息;
[0024]语音参数信息采集单元,用于采集所述终端在语音通话时的语音参数信息。
[0025]进一步优选的,所述语音质量信息为根据预先设定的语音质量标准划分的不同数值;
[0026]所述语音参数信息包括IMEI (Internat1nal Mobile Equipment Identity,移动设备国际身份码)、软件版本号、运营商编号、SIM卡(Subscriber Identity Module,客户识别模块)编号、基站ID、信号强度和信号质量。
[0027]本发明从用户感知的角度来评价通话质量,建立在大量主观测试的基础上,分析现代通讯系统中的设备性能基础上,建立通话质量与主观评分的方法和系统,具有更优的测试效果。
[0028]进一步优选的,所述处理模块包括解析单元,用于接收并解析所述第二通信单元发送的所述测试信息得到所述测试数据;
[0029]分类单元,用于按照预先设定的环境标准对存储的所述测试数据进行分类得到分类测试数据;
[0030]统计单元,用于统计所述分类测试数据中的所述语音质量信息,得到通话质量测试结果;
[0031]存储单元,用于存储所述测试数据、所述分类测试数据以及所述通话质量测试结果O
[0032]本发明还提供一种通话质量测试方法,应用于上述系统,所述方法包括:
[0033]步骤I检测所述终端是否满足测试条件,若是,执行下一步;否则结束测试;
[0034]步骤2启动通话质量测试,采集所述终端的测试数据;
[0035]步骤3根据所述测试数据生成测试信息并发送至服务器;
[0036]步骤4接收并解析所述测试信息获取所述测试信息,统计所述测试数据得到通话质量测试结果。
[0037]进一步优选的,所述步骤I检测所述终端是否满足测试条件具体包括:
[0038]步骤11检测所述终端当前网络是否满足语音通话条件,若是,执行下一步;否则,结束测试;
[0039]步骤12判断当前启动通话测试命令的发送次数是否低于第一预设阈值,若是,执行下一步;否则,结束测试;
[0040]步骤13当终端一次语音通话结束时,统计通话时长,判断所述通话时长是否达到第二预设阈值,若是,执行下一步;否则,结束测试;
[0041]步骤14发送启动通话质量测试命令,同时累加一次所述发送次数;
[0042]步骤15判断当前启动通话测试命令的发送次数是否低于第一预设阈值,若是,重复执行步骤13 ;否则,结束测试。
[0043]进一步优选的,所述测试数据包括语音质量信息和语音参数信息;
[0044]所述语音质量信息为根据预先设定的语音质量标准划分的不同数值;
[0045]所述语音参数信息包括ME1、软件版本号、运营商编号、SM卡编号、基站ID、信号强度和信号质量。
[0046]进一步优选的,所述步骤4具体包括:
[0047]步骤41接收并解析所述第二通信单元发送的所述测试信息,得到所述测试数据并存储;
[0048]步骤42按照预先设定的环境标准对存储的所述测试数据进行分类,得到分类测试数据并存储;
[0049]步骤43统计所述分类测试数据中的所述语音质量信息,得到通话质量测试结果并存储。
[0050]通过本发明提供的通话质量测试系统及方法,能够带来以下至少一种有益效果:
[0051]1.本发明从单一的通话测试方式提升到多用户不同环境下测试方式,能根据不同网络环境,不同人群,客观地反映出手机
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1